For most digital manufacturing service bureaus, quoting doesn’t happen in isolation. A quote touches customer records in your CRM, feeds job data into your ERP, and eventually turns into an invoice in your accounting system. When those systems don’t talk to each other, your team pays the price in duplicated data entry, transcription errors, and slower turnaround on every RFQ.

This guide walks through why integrating your quoting process with the rest of your tech stack matters, what data should flow where, and how to approach it without disrupting the shop floor.

Why disconnected quoting slows you down

Standalone quoting tools and spreadsheets create islands of information. An estimator prices a job, then someone rekeys the customer details into the CRM, opens a work order in the ERP, and later recreates the same numbers in accounting to raise an invoice. Each hand-off is a chance to introduce mistakes and lose time.

The operational costs add up quickly:

  • Slower lead times. Manual re-entry delays the moment a won quote becomes a live job on the floor.
  • Margin leakage. Pricing that’s copied by hand can drift from the version the customer approved.
  • Poor visibility. When quote data lives outside your ERP, production managers can’t see what’s coming down the pipe.
  • Follow-up gaps. Quotes that never sync to the CRM are quotes nobody chases.

For a busy service bureau processing dozens of quotes a week, these frictions directly limit throughput and conversion.

What data should flow between systems

Integration isn’t about connecting everything to everything. It’s about moving the right information at the right moment. A well-designed setup typically covers three directions of data flow.

Quoting to CRM

Every quote should create or update a customer record automatically. That means contact details, the parts quoted, pricing, and quote status all live in the CRM without anyone retyping them. Your sales and estimating teams can then track open opportunities, set follow-up reminders, and measure win rates by customer or process.

Quoting to ERP

When a quote is accepted, it should convert cleanly into a work order or job in your ERP. Material specifications, quantities, deadlines, and agreed pricing carry over intact. This is where accurate quoting pays off on the floor: production planning, purchasing, and scheduling all rely on data that originated in the quote.

Quoting and ERP to accounting

Approved pricing should feed invoicing without a second round of data entry. When the quote, the job, and the invoice all reference the same source figures, you reduce billing disputes and close the loop from RFQ to payment.

The role of a customizable quote engine

Integration only works if the quoting logic reflects how your shop actually prices work. A generic calculator that doesn’t understand your processes, materials, and machine rates will push flawed numbers into every downstream system.

That’s why a quote engine tailored to your specific manufacturing processes matters. Whether you run 3D printing, CNC machining, or sheet metal fabrication, the pricing rules need to account for your materials, setup times, nesting efficiency, and finishing steps. Get the source of truth right, and everything that flows from it — CRM opportunities, ERP work orders, accounting invoices — inherits that accuracy.

Connecting quoting to your existing stack

You’ve likely already invested in an ERP, a CRM, and accounting software that your team knows well. The goal of integration isn’t to replace those — it’s to feed them better data, faster.

The payoff: speed, accuracy, and capacity

When quoting is integrated with the rest of your systems, the benefits compound. Estimators quote faster because they aren’t juggling tools. Production sees jobs sooner, shortening lead times. Accounting bills from the same numbers the customer approved, protecting margins. And with quote data flowing into your CRM, no opportunity slips through the cracks.
